What Are Box Section (HSS) and Bent Steel Plate for Modern Staircase?

Box Section / Hollow Structural Section (HSS) – Hollow structural sections (HSS) are high-strength welded steel tubing available in rectangular, square, or circular shapes. For a modern staircase, HSS provides a clean, minimalist look with excellent structural performance.

Box section vs bent steel plate comparison for modern staircase

Bent Steel Plate / Folded Steel Plate – Bent steel plate is a flat steel plate that is formed – typically using a press brake, plate rolling, or section bender – into a custom shape. Engineers widely use bent plate structural steel for curved stringers, mono stringers, and architectural stair components in modern stair systems designs.

Box Section vs Bent Plate: Structural Strength Comparison for Modern Staircase

When designing a modern staircase, structural strength is paramount. HSS steel meaning in construction is all about structural strength & load capacity. The closed cross-section of HSS provides excellent torsional rigidity – ideal for mono stringers and cantilever designs in a this application. It also offers high flexural strength that resists bending in multiple directions, with consistent section properties that ensure predictable engineering calculations.

Buildings, bridges, and staircases commonly use HSS as a primary structural member. This makes it a reliable choice for any stair system project.

Bent Steel Plate – Flexible but Demanding

Bent steel plate offers good load-bearing capacity. Its strength depends on plate thickness and profile design. It provides adaptability that can be shaped to match complex curves, which is essential for curved modern staircase designs. However, variable section properties require more engineering attention compared to HSS.

Box Section vs Bent Plate: Fabrication Complexity for Modern Staircase

Box Section – Pre-Formed and Standardized

In contrast,Box stringer fabrication (also known as RHS – Rectangular Hollow Section) is relatively standardized for modern staircase construction. Profile Comparison shows available in standard sizes. Welded steel construction requires less complex fabrication than bent plate.Installation difficulty is lower – sections fit together more easily, which is a significant advantage for residential stair designs projects with tight timelines.

Fabrication & Processing for HSS in a modern staircase involves:

  1. Cutting – Laser cutting or sawing
  2. Bending – Induction bending for curves (specialized equipment required)
  3. Welding – Standard welding processes
  4. Finishing – Paint or powder coating

Bent Steel Plate – Custom and Complex

For a commercial stair projects with curved or complex geometry, bent steel plate offers superior design flexibility. However, this comes with increased fabrication complexity. Bent plate requires skilled labor for forming, more demanding welding requirements, and careful quality control to ensure consistent profiles. For straight modern staircase designs, the complexity is moderate, but for curved applications, it becomes significantly higher.

Cost Comparison: Box Section vs Bent Steel Plate for Modern Staircase

Factor de costoBox Section (HSS)Bent Steel Plate
Material costLower – standardizedHigher – custom sizes
Engineering costLower – predictableHigher – custom calculations
Fabrication costLower – less laborHigher – skilled labor required
Installation costLowerHigher

Nevertheless,For straight modern staircase designs, HSS is more cost-effective. For curved the overall structure designs, bent plate may be necessary despite higher cost, as it can follow complex curves that HSS cannot accommodate.
